Particle dark matter signal in DAMA/LIBRA

摘要

The DAMA/LIBRA experiment, running at LNGS, has a sensitive mass of about 250 kg highly radiopure Nal(Tl) and it is mainly devoted to the investigation of Dark Matter (DM) particles in the Galactic halo by exploiting the model independent DM annual modulation signature. The present DAMA/LIBRA experiment and the former DAMA/Nal one have released so far results corresponding to a total exposure of 1.17 ton x yr over 13 annual cycles. They provide a model independent evidence of the presence of DM particles in the galactic halo at 8.9σ C.L.
